($40,000 a year) … WebMar 21, 2024 · Your remaining pension, employment, and property income is £64,000. There’s no tax due on the first £12,570 of your combined income. You pay 20% tax (£7,540) on your income between £12,571 and £50,270. You pay 40% tax (£5,492) on your income between £50,271 and £64,000. You take home £56,968 after tax.
